Output 99a1d837666415a26493af5d7cd2800e96a26b57a3b9835da9c576f8a62d9640:2

value
26665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ba399082c8a02c14f5e190931365393d22796894 OP_EQUAL
address
3JfgZsjPFMayhit1QDve9WskUMmWGfSwU8
transaction
99a1d837666415a26493af5d7cd2800e96a26b57a3b9835da9c576f8a62d9640
spent
true